Presented by Alien Feedings, Burning Matches is the stories of people who love riding bikes - and often love racing bikes - and the lessons, joy, peace and power we can all gain from them. Kurt Hoffmann is a former Cat 2 Junior bike racer who raced for the St. Louis Cycling Club during one of its heydays in the 1980s. Founded in 1887, SLCC is the oldest cycling club in the US. Kurt returned to bike racing in 2022 for Northern California bike racing team Red Peloton. "Cycling has always been the greatest outlet for me and became even more important to me as I went through some extremely challenging times in 2024. The cycling community and time spent on my bike were my salvation. I realized how much I love these people and this activity and wanted to explore the stories of my fellow riders who share this love." Kurt Hoffmann What is Does Burning Matches Mean? In cycling, "burning matches" means you've put forth an intense effort that zapped a good chunk of your available strength, endurance or other riding capabilities. For a competitive ride, race or just personal effort, we only have so many matches to burn. A critical path to success is managing your matches. Hosted on Acast.
